Understanding Apple Watch Cellular
Before diving into the specifics of apple watch consumer cellular, it’s crucial to understand the concept of cellular connectivity in wearable devices. An Apple Watch with cellular capabilities allows you to make calls, send messages, and access various apps independently of your iPhone. This feature is particularly beneficial for those who engage in activities that might separate them from their phone, such as workouts, running errands, or traveling.
